Namco brings Pac-Man Championship Edition to iPhone

Game expands on original Pac-Man levels


Namco has released an iPhone port of Pac-Man Championship Edition, originally developed for the Xbox Live Arcade. The title replicates the original Pac-Man gameplay, but expands on it with multiple modes. The signature Championship Mode asks players to get the highest possible score within three to five minutes, while Mission Mode has gamers try for a series of tasks, each completed in roughly a minute.

One of four different control schemes can be used, depending on preferences. By default the game includes five mazes, and 20 missions; a paid expansion adds 10 more mazes, and 100 more missions. The base game costs $3, and runs on any iPhone or iPod with v3.x firmware.
